If a vector `2hat(i)+3hat(j)+8hat(k)` is perpendicular to the vector `4hat(j)-4hat(i)+alpha hat(k)`. Then the value of `alpha` isA. -1B. `1/2`C. `-1/2`D. 1 |
|
Answer» Correct Answer - C We are given `vec(a)= 2hat(i)+3hat(j)+8hat(k), vec(b)= 4hat(j)-4hat(i)+alpha hat(k)` According to the above hypothesis, If `vec(a)_|_ vec(b)`, then dot product of Vector should be zero `vec(a).vec(b)=0` `implies (2hat(i)+3hat(j)+8hat(k))(-4hat(i)+4hat(j)+alpha hat(k))=0` `implies -8+12+8 alpha=0implies 8 alpha = -4` `:. alpha= -4/8= -1/2` |
